If there's an accident during a Formula One race, parts of the car often remain on the track or a car can stop in a dangerous position. If this happens, then the Mercedes-Benz SLS AMG Safety Car and its driver, Bernd Mayländer, come to the fore. This feature shows Bernd Mayländer's tasks and duties, as well as everything Formula One drivers have to take into account during a Safety Car phase:
